A gist to explain the difference between Number and parseInt for coercing and parsing strings to numbers
// Number
var secretNumber = 4;
var stringGuess = prompt("Guess a number");
var guess = Number(stringGuess);
// parseInt
var secretNumber = 7;
var stringGuess = prompt("Guess a number");
var guess = parseInt(stringGuess);